Principal Java Developer

  • SPK Consultants Inc
  • Burlington, MA, 01803

Posted on

Job Description:

*Direct Client Requirement*

 

Principal/Senior Java Developer

Location: Burlington, MA

Duration: 12+ month Contract to Hire

 

 

VISA: H1B, USC, H4EAD, GC, TN Visa all acceptable.

 

 

Job Description:

 

The Sr. or Principal Java developer will work on developing new middle tier/server side functionality for the trading system. This is an opportunity to work within a very strong, senior level engineering team and help to develop challenging new products in the financial space.

 

 

Skills Required:

  • 8+ years with Core Java, strong SQL, Java nTier Software development, multi-threaded development, XML/XSL etc.
  • Must come from Fintech, financial services, banking, investment bank or hedgefund companies.

 

Responsibilities:

  • Influence and impact the architecture, standards, and design of key product initiatives for applications in Java
  • Contribute as a Sr. individual contributor within a team of top engineers
  • Work in a dynamic, fast-paced, Agile team environment

 

Requirements:

  • BS/MS in Computer Science or equivalent field
  • 7 to 10+ years of commercial software development, proficient in developing multi-tier solutions
  • Sr. Individual Contributor or Architect level considered the top within their organization
  • Minimum 5 years of professional Java development experience
  • Financial industry experience is ideal but not required; specific development experience of a financial application is a huge plus. Experience developing applications for the financial markets is highly desirable (Fixed Income, Trading, FX, Risk, Portfolio/Wealth Management, Market Data, FIX etc.)

 

Technical experience includes:

  • Extensive Java n-tier application experience
  • Hands-on experience with web services
  • Strong SQL skills with considerable experience in Oracle or SQL Server
  • Knowledge of XML / XSL
  • Experience with Tomcat, JBoss, WebLogic or WebSphere
  • Strong with OO design and development
  • Solid grasp of algorithms and solving difficult heuristic/optimization types of problems

 

Product delivery experience includes:

  • Has been a key player in developing and supporting commercial software products which were sold to non-technical customers in vertical markets
  • Ability to work independently, handle multiple tasks simultaneously and adapt quickly to changes
  • Excellent communication skills (verbal and written), good interpersonal skills, ability to gather and understand requirements in the financial sector

 

 

Regards,

Sansi | SPK Consultants INC

Office: (408) 933-9546

Email : Sansi@SPKconsultantsinc.com

 


Company Description:

We are SPK Consultants Inc, a leading information, communications and technology (ICT) company providing top-class business consulting, information technology, consulting services, business process outsourcing and staffing solutions. Leveraging deep industry and functional expertise, leading technology practices and a global delivery model, we enable companies achieve their business goals and transformation objectives. 

http://spkconsultantsinc.com/